To protect and serve Oregon's consumers and workers while supporting a positive business climate. The Department of Consumer and Business Services (DCBS) is a progressive business regulatory state agency dedicated to the mission of protecting and serving Oregon's consumers and workers while supporting a positive business climate. The department administers state laws and rules governing workers' compensation, occupational safety and health, financial institutions, insurance companies and building codes. The department has consumer protection and education programs, offices, and ombuds to help consumers, injured workers, and businesses. This position is with the Information Technology and Research (IT&R) Section of the Central Services Division. IT&R provides a broad range of specialized technical services in the areas of information systems, data analysis/dissemination, and computer/telecommunication services for a large, diverse agency. The staff support the collection, processing, analysis, and dissemination of statewide and regional data about workers' compensation, accident prevention, insurance, financial institutions, corporate securities, building codes, and senior health insurance benefits. The section supports a number of critical systems to meet the regulatory requirements for each program and interact with other state and federal agencies. Here's what you will do: As a Database Developer, you will provide technical expertise and support in using database technology for database applications, interfaces, data transfer mechanisms and business intelligence platforms critical to DCBS. You will work with the Architects and/or Senior DBA on effective data retrieval, resolution of data related incidents and/or requests. You will also initiate, plan and execute IT projects of small and medium size and complexity under the guidance and direction of manager, PMO manager or project manager.
